The Bahrain Institute of Banking and Finance (BIBF) and Bank Albilad, one of Saudi Arabia’s leading banks, have signed a co-operation agreement to deliver specialised training programmes under the “Albilad AI” programme.

The agreement reflects both organisations’ commitment to developing national talent, improving digital readiness and helping employees use artificial intelligence in the banking sector.

The agreement comes as banks and financial institutions continue to adopt AI at a faster pace. The programme will give Bank Albilad employees the practical knowledge and skills they need to understand and use AI technologies. It will also help improve operational efficiency, support innovation and enhance the customer experience.

Under the agreement, BIBF will design and deliver the training programmes in line with the latest international practices. The programmes will provide participants with advanced skills to use AI across different areas of banking and financial services.

The partnership reflects the commitment of both organisations to investing in people and preparing skilled professionals who can keep up with rapid technological change. It will also help employees make better use of the opportunities offered by AI to support growth and innovation.

Commenting on the agreement, BIBF Chief Executive Officer Dr Ahmed Al Shaikh said: “We are pleased to work with Bank Albilad on this important initiative, which reflects our shared commitment to developing people and helping them benefit from the opportunities offered by artificial intelligence.

He also added, “The ‘Albilad AI’ programme also reflects our commitment to providing modern learning and training experiences that improve digital readiness and support organisational transformation in the banking and financial sector.”

Bank Albilad General Manager of Human Resources Excellence Yasser Sulaiman Al-Dukhail said: “Investing in our employees and developing their skills is a key part of Bank Albilad’s strategy for innovation and organisational excellence.

“Through our partnership with BIBF, we aim to provide our national talent with advanced AI skills. This will help improve operational efficiency, support the delivery of more advanced banking services to our customers and contribute to Saudi Arabia’s digital transformation goals.” He added.

The agreement is an important step towards building a stronger culture of innovation and encouraging the use of emerging technologies in the banking sector. It will support the strategic goals of both organisations and contribute to the development of the financial sector across the region.

The partnership also confirms the commitment of BIBF and Bank Albilad to developing human capital and supporting innovation in the financial and banking sector across the GCC.

BIBF continues to provide specialised training and education programmes that meet the needs of financial and banking institutions. These programmes help prepare skilled professionals for the digital future and support continued development and innovation across the region.
